The price of an oil change in a "quick" lube is expensive but you can just as easily call it a convenience lube. It's like buying a gallon of milk at a convenience store compared to going to HEB. You run into your corner convenience store and you're in and out quickly but costing more. It's the same thing with a quick lube. You're paying for the quick. And trust me those guys such as at Mr Roddy's business earn it working on hot engines. If you take your vehicle somewhere like a dealership you're going to have to wait a bit but they can be cheaper (and your vehicle will be a lot cooler when they work on it LOL). If you change your own oil it can be cheaper. On the average about $20 bucks with a name brand oil (Castrol 5 quarts average $15 and a filter $5 bucks) then you have to crawl under your car drain the oil, change the filter, add oil and check it. 10-15 minutes for average person to do only that much. Quick lube will check ALL fluids (top them off if needed), tires, filters (air filter, fuel filter etc,)Check belts, hoses, battery levels, This is just basic service. The fast lube that I managed (in another town) also vacuumed the front floor boards and washed your windshield. All of this is done in about 10 - 12 minutes. Plus they maintain shop insurance. If they damage anything on your vehicle they have insurance to cover it. If you mess it up doing it yourself you have to pay to fix it. The cost of oil is only small percentage of cost of oil change and usually the increase in oil price is not completely passed on to consumers such as in Mr Roddy's case. Have you ever heard of a neighborhood watch. The deputy is trying to tell you that he can't do anything at this point because it is simply your word against theirs. If enough neighbors observe this and are willing to testify then it isn't a he said she said situation anymore. If you can get something documented ( pictures, video etc.) even better. I am a former deputy (from another area) and while unfortunate the way the law is worded basically does nothing to help the victims. The suspect has to either be caught in the act by law enforcement or on video tape which clearly shows the suspect committing an offense.
Contact the investigators at the County and let them know what is going on and ask them very simply what do I have to do to get something done. Ask them if pictures will work. Tell them exactly what has happened and when deputies have been there. They should be able to access the deputy's reports and advise you on how best to handle the situation. They probably have no knowledge of the incidents so don't go in raising H#@% with them. Keep calling CPS about the foster parents and document everything you see wrong at the residence.
